> I do see some apparent misbehaviour with hid.exe: only buttons 1 through 8
> are reported; the throttle is not reported anywhere (though the yaw does
> work), and the hat switch only seems to be reported when pressed upwards.
> However, this seems to be a reflection of bugs in hid.exe itself; I see the
> same behaviour on Windows. (Actually, Windows seems worse for some reason:
> it doesn't acknowledge yaw, the X axis doesn't seem to work right, and the
> hat switch only registers as "up" inconsistently.)

Sorry for not being more specific: the comments were reflecting incremental
testing, so the logs pasted in comment 9 were with the default settings in the
registry.

I have now disabled SDL and evdev in the registry, and I now see the exact same
behaviour you see in hid.exe.
However the situation in BF4 is now worse - while before X/Y axis and some keys
worked, now nothing does. No button, no axis - it's completely dead in the
water.
joy.cpl continues to work perfectly, it recognises everything correctly.

I'll attach the logs of bf4.exe ran with +hid,+hid_report,+plugplay - games
starts, went into settings, tried to bind a key to any joystick action.
